Simple transposon is an insertion sequence that contains it's own coding transposase between the short inverted repeated sequences that flank it's gene coding region.

Simple transposition is also called cut and paste transposition because the element is cut out of its original site and pasted to the new one.

It requires many transposase enzymes which cleaves specific host sequence and produce staggered ends.

The transposon which has inverted repeat sequences inserts between the staggered ends of host sequence which then gets ligated to the transposon.
